The Problem: Dead Battery, Going Nowhere
The old days of cycling the choke, working the throttle and yarding on a pull start (or thrashing a kickstart) until your limbs are about to fall off are over. Thank gawd! Anyone who has rebuilt a pull start recoil or replaced a kickstart shaft knows what we’re talking about.
Most powersports vehicles today use an electric start system. The reasons are pretty obvious: on smaller engines they are convenient and require no effort or strength, and larger displacement engines would be physically difficult or impossible to start manually.
This transition has been supported by modern fuel-injected engines that require only a minimum of electric power to operate the fuel pump and ECU, along with the improved efficiency and reliability of modern batteries and starter motors.
However!
The downside is most powersports vehicles are manufactured now without a backup manual starter. This means for riders who are taking their vehicles off-trail or into remote areas, there is a real risk of becoming stranded if the battery drains to the point that it cannot power the starter.

The majority of 450+ cc displacement dirt bikes do not offer a kickstart, leading snowbike riders to know better than anyone the importance of having a battery booster on hand, lest they become stranded
This is a bigger concern for powersports vehicles than it is for cars and trucks, because powersports vehicle batteries are more vulnerable than automobile batteries, for a few reasons:
- Lower amp-hour capacity
- Sensitivity to cold temperatures
- Greater exposure to vibration, water, dirt and temperature swings
- Lower tolerance for periods of inactivity, between rides for example

Now, a battery failure isn’t such a big deal when you’re at or near home. But this becomes a legitimate safety concern when your ride takes you into remote areas that have:
- Little to no cell coverage
- Limited traffic or help around
- Harsh environmental conditions
- Rugged terrain
When you’re riding in the backcountry or far from other people and help, the ability to reliably start your vehicle is a lifeline!

And here’s one final feature of the MINI BOOST that not all battery boosters provide!
In the case of a zero (or very low) voltage battery condition (which will happen when a battery is fully drained or very close to it), many other brand boosters will read this as an incorrect connection condition which will prevent the user from being able to boost the battery! Imagine how defeating it would be to try to use your battery booster in the backcountry only to discover that it doesn’t work on a fully drained battery.
To solve this, the Mountain Lab MINI BOOST features a manual override button that will allow the user to boost even a fully drained battery. Don’t worry, we’ve got you covered.
